A Snapshot of Your Day

As a key member of the IPS Parts Organization within Gas Services (GS), your day revolves around ensuring the smooth global movement of industrial-scale power generation equipment. You manage the import, export, and transshipment of tools, materials, units, and equipment, playing a crucial role in meeting project timelines! From processing customs documentation to coordinating shipments, you ensure all activities follow international trade regulations. Your expertise supports the flawless integration of critical assets across global sites. By keeping operations efficient and compliant, you directly contribute to the success of power generation projects worldwide!

How You’ll Make an Impact

  • Oversee global import/export operations, including customs compliance, shipping, receiving, and transport execution for large-scale power plant projects.
  • Ensure adherence to domestic and international regulations, customer requirements, and internal logistics standards while maintaining accurate documentation and data.
  • Coordinate with cross-functional teams (Sales, Proposal Management, Purchasing, Engineering, and PLM) to define logistics scope, develop transport strategies, and support proposal bids with accurate cost and schedule estimates.
  • Analyze logistics performance, identify risks or delay, propose and implement corrective actions, and communicate material availability and shipment status to stakeholders.
  • Manage carrier selection and vendor performance, prepare transportation proposals, evaluate bids, and ensure cost-effective, damage-free delivery while resolving complaints and logistics-related issues.
  • Drive process improvements and support project closeout, including return logistics, contingency planning, supplier evaluation, and continuous optimization of logistics processes and client solutions.

What You Bring

  • Bachelor’s degree with 8–10 years of dynamic logistics and transportation experience, ideally within global EPC, power firms, or project logistics providers.
  • Validated expertise in project logistics management, including multi-modal transport execution, Incoterms, export/import compliance, and documentation (e.g., ocean B/L, AWB, letters of credit).
  • Solid understanding of domestic and international regulations, safety standards, and preferential trade agreements, with the ability to plan work independently and guide others.
  • Proven success in problem-solving, decision-making, and effectively communicating technical and logistical data across diverse teams and stakeholders.
  • Highly hard-working, adaptable to changing priorities across multiple projects, with a diligent approach to continuous improvement and innovation.

Who is Siemens Energy?

At Siemens Energy, we are more than just an energy technology company. With ~100,000 dedicated employees in more than 90 countries, we develop the energy systems of the future, ensuring that the growing energy demand of the global community is met reliably and sustainably. The technologies created in our research departments and factories drive the energy transition and provide the base for one sixth of the world's electricity generation.

Our global team is committed to making sustainable, reliable, and affordable energy a reality by pushing the boundaries of what is possible. We uphold a 150-year legacy of innovation that encourages our search for people who will support our focus on decarbonization, new technologies, and energy transformation.
